DOWNLOAD EBOOKJacob Hostetter (d.1761), a Mennonite and a bishop, immigrated in 1712 from Switzerland to Lancaster County, Pennsylvania. Oswald Hostetter (1702-1749), also a Mennonite, immigrated in 1732 from Switzerland to Lancaster County, Pennsylvania. Descendants and relatives lived in Pennsylvania, Virginia, Maryland, New Jersey, Nebraska, Missouri, Oklahoma, Louisiana and elsewhere.
